* fix(web): resolve file upload config lookup for server-rendered forms
The file upload widget's getUploadConfig() function failed to map
server-rendered field IDs (e.g., "static-image-images") back to schema
property keys ("images"), causing upload config (plugin_id, endpoint,
allowed_types) to be lost. This could prevent image uploads from
working correctly in the static-image plugin and others.
Changes:
- Add data-* attributes to the Jinja2 file-upload template so upload
config is embedded directly on the file input element
- Update getUploadConfig() in both file-upload.js and plugins_manager.js
to read config from data attributes first, falling back to schema lookup
- Remove duplicate handleFiles/handleFileDrop/handleFileSelect from
plugins_manager.js that overwrote the more robust file-upload.js versions
- Bump cache-busting version strings so browsers fetch updated JS

LEDMatrix Widget Development Guide
Overview
The LEDMatrix Widget Registry system allows plugins to use reusable UI components (widgets) for configuration forms. This system enables:
- Reusable Components: Use existing widgets (file upload, checkboxes, etc.) without custom code
- Custom Widgets: Create plugin-specific widgets without modifying the LEDMatrix codebase
- Backwards Compatibility: Existing plugins continue to work without changes
Available Core Widgets
1. File Upload Widget (file-upload)
Upload and manage image files with drag-and-drop support, preview, delete, and scheduling.
Schema Configuration:
{
"type": "array",
"x-widget": "file-upload",
"x-upload-config": {
"plugin_id": "my-plugin",
"max_files": 10,
"max_size_mb": 5,
"allowed_types": ["image/png", "image/jpeg", "image/bmp", "image/gif"]
}
}
Features:
- Drag and drop file upload
- Image preview with thumbnails
- Delete functionality
- Schedule images to show at specific times
- Progress indicators during upload
2. Checkbox Group Widget (checkbox-group)
Multi-select checkboxes for array fields with enum items.
Schema Configuration:
{
"type": "array",
"x-widget": "checkbox-group",
"items": {
"type": "string",
"enum": ["option1", "option2", "option3"]
},
"x-options": {
"labels": {
"option1": "Option 1 Label",
"option2": "Option 2 Label"
}
}
}
Features:
- Multiple selection from enum list
- Custom labels for each option
- Automatic JSON array serialization
3. Custom Feeds Widget (custom-feeds)
Table-based RSS feed editor with logo uploads.
Schema Configuration:
{
"type": "array",
"x-widget": "custom-feeds",
"items": {
"type": "object",
"properties": {
"name": { "type": "string" },
"url": { "type": "string", "format": "uri" },
"enabled": { "type": "boolean" },
"logo": { "type": "object" }
}
},
"maxItems": 50
}
Features:
- Add/remove feed rows
- Logo upload per feed
- Enable/disable individual feeds
- Automatic row re-indexing
Using Existing Widgets
To use an existing widget in your plugin's config_schema.json, simply add the x-widget property to your field definition:
{
"properties": {
"my_images": {
"type": "array",
"x-widget": "file-upload",
"x-upload-config": {
"plugin_id": "my-plugin",
"max_files": 5
}
}
}
}
The widget will be automatically rendered when the plugin configuration form is loaded.
Creating Custom Widgets
Step 1: Create Widget File
Create a JavaScript file in your plugin directory (e.g., widgets/my-widget.js):
// Ensure LEDMatrixWidgets registry is available
if (typeof window.LEDMatrixWidgets === 'undefined') {
console.error('LEDMatrixWidgets registry not found');
return;
}
// Register your widget
window.LEDMatrixWidgets.register('my-custom-widget', {
name: 'My Custom Widget',
version: '1.0.0',
/**
* Render the widget HTML
* @param {HTMLElement} container - Container element to render into
* @param {Object} config - Widget configuration from schema
* @param {*} value - Current value
* @param {Object} options - Additional options (fieldId, pluginId, etc.)
*/
render: function(container, config, value, options) {
const fieldId = options.fieldId || container.id;
// Sanitize fieldId for safe use in DOM IDs and selectors
const sanitizeId = (id) => String(id).replace(/[^a-zA-Z0-9_-]/g, '_');
const safeFieldId = sanitizeId(fieldId);
const html = `
<div class="my-custom-widget">
<input type="text"
id="${safeFieldId}_input"
value="${this.escapeHtml(value || '')}"
class="w-full px-3 py-2 border border-gray-300 rounded">
</div>
`;
container.innerHTML = html;
// Attach event listeners
const input = container.querySelector(`#${safeFieldId}_input`);
if (input) {
input.addEventListener('change', (e) => {
this.handlers.onChange(fieldId, e.target.value);
});
}
},
/**
* Get current value from widget
* @param {string} fieldId - Field ID
* @returns {*} Current value
*/
getValue: function(fieldId) {
// Sanitize fieldId for safe selector use
const sanitizeId = (id) => String(id).replace(/[^a-zA-Z0-9_-]/g, '_');
const safeFieldId = sanitizeId(fieldId);
const input = document.querySelector(`#${safeFieldId}_input`);
return input ? input.value : null;
},
/**
* Set value programmatically
* @param {string} fieldId - Field ID
* @param {*} value - Value to set
*/
setValue: function(fieldId, value) {
// Sanitize fieldId for safe selector use
const sanitizeId = (id) => String(id).replace(/[^a-zA-Z0-9_-]/g, '_');
const safeFieldId = sanitizeId(fieldId);
const input = document.querySelector(`#${safeFieldId}_input`);
if (input) {
input.value = value || '';
}
},
/**
* Event handlers
*/
handlers: {
onChange: function(fieldId, value) {
// Trigger form change event
const event = new CustomEvent('widget-change', {
detail: { fieldId, value },
bubbles: true
});
document.dispatchEvent(event);
}
},
/**
* Helper: Escape HTML to prevent XSS
*/
escapeHtml: function(text) {
const div = document.createElement('div');
div.textContent = text;
return div.innerHTML;
},
/**
* Helper: Sanitize identifier for use in DOM IDs and CSS selectors
*/
sanitizeId: function(id) {
return String(id).replace(/[^a-zA-Z0-9_-]/g, '_');
}
});
Step 2: Reference Widget in Schema
In your plugin's config_schema.json:
{
"properties": {
"my_field": {
"type": "string",
"description": "My custom field",
"x-widget": "my-custom-widget",
"default": ""
}
}
}
Step 3: Widget Loading
The widget will be automatically loaded when the plugin configuration form is rendered. The system will:
- Check if widget is registered in the core registry
- If not found, attempt to load from plugin directory:
/static/plugin-widgets/[plugin-id]/[widget-name].js - Render the widget using the registered
renderfunction
Widget API Reference
Widget Definition Object
{
name: string, // Human-readable widget name
version: string, // Widget version
render: function, // Required: Render function
getValue: function, // Optional: Get current value
setValue: function, // Optional: Set value programmatically
handlers: object // Optional: Event handlers
}
Render Function
render(container, config, value, options)
Parameters:
container(HTMLElement): Container element to render intoconfig(Object): Widget configuration from schema (x-widget-configor schema properties)value(*): Current field valueoptions(Object): Additional optionsfieldId(string): Field IDpluginId(string): Plugin IDfullKey(string): Full field key path
Get Value Function
getValue(fieldId)
Returns: Current widget value
Set Value Function
setValue(fieldId, value)
Parameters:
fieldId(string): Field IDvalue(*): Value to set
Event Handlers
Widgets can define custom event handlers in the handlers object:
handlers: {
onChange: function(fieldId, value) {
// Handle value change
},
onFocus: function(fieldId) {
// Handle focus
}
}
Best Practices
Security
- Always escape HTML: Use
escapeHtml()ortextContentto prevent XSS - Validate inputs: Validate user input before processing
- Sanitize values: Clean values before storing
- Sanitize identifiers: Always sanitize identifiers (like
fieldId) used as element IDs and in CSS selectors to prevent selector injection/XSS:- Use
sanitizeId()helper function (available in BaseWidget) or create your own - Allow only safe characters:
[A-Za-z0-9_-] - Replace or remove invalid characters before using in:
getElementById(),querySelector(),querySelectorAll()- Setting
idattributes - Building CSS selectors
- Never interpolate raw
fieldIdinto HTML strings or selectors without sanitization - Example:
const safeId = fieldId.replace(/[^a-zA-Z0-9_-]/g, '_');
- Use
Performance
- Lazy loading: Load widget scripts only when needed
- Event delegation: Use event delegation for dynamic content
- Debounce: Debounce frequent events (e.g., input changes)
Accessibility
- Labels: Always associate labels with inputs
- ARIA attributes: Use appropriate ARIA attributes
- Keyboard navigation: Ensure keyboard accessibility
Error Handling
- Graceful degradation: Handle missing dependencies
- User feedback: Show clear error messages
- Logging: Log errors for debugging
Examples
Example 1: Color Picker Widget
window.LEDMatrixWidgets.register('color-picker', {
name: 'Color Picker',
version: '1.0.0',
render: function(container, config, value, options) {
const fieldId = options.fieldId;
// Sanitize fieldId for safe use in DOM IDs and selectors
const sanitizeId = (id) => String(id).replace(/[^a-zA-Z0-9_-]/g, '_');
const sanitizedFieldId = sanitizeId(fieldId);
container.innerHTML = `
<div class="flex items-center space-x-2">
<input type="color"
id="${sanitizedFieldId}_color"
value="${value || '#000000'}"
class="h-10 w-20">
<input type="text"
id="${sanitizedFieldId}_hex"
value="${value || '#000000'}"
pattern="^#[0-9A-Fa-f]{6}$"
class="px-2 py-1 border rounded">
</div>
`;
const colorInput = container.querySelector(`#${sanitizedFieldId}_color`);
const hexInput = container.querySelector(`#${sanitizedFieldId}_hex`);
if (colorInput && hexInput) {
colorInput.addEventListener('change', (e) => {
hexInput.value = e.target.value;
this.handlers.onChange(fieldId, e.target.value);
});
hexInput.addEventListener('change', (e) => {
if (/^#[0-9A-Fa-f]{6}$/.test(e.target.value)) {
colorInput.value = e.target.value;
this.handlers.onChange(fieldId, e.target.value);
}
});
}
},
getValue: function(fieldId) {
// Sanitize fieldId for safe selector use
const sanitizeId = (id) => String(id).replace(/[^a-zA-Z0-9_-]/g, '_');
const sanitizedFieldId = sanitizeId(fieldId);
const colorInput = document.querySelector(`#${sanitizedFieldId}_color`);
return colorInput ? colorInput.value : null;
},
setValue: function(fieldId, value) {
// Sanitize fieldId for safe selector use
const sanitizeId = (id) => String(id).replace(/[^a-zA-Z0-9_-]/g, '_');
const sanitizedFieldId = sanitizeId(fieldId);
const colorInput = document.querySelector(`#${sanitizedFieldId}_color`);
const hexInput = document.querySelector(`#${sanitizedFieldId}_hex`);
if (colorInput && hexInput) {
colorInput.value = value;
hexInput.value = value;
}
},
handlers: {
onChange: function(fieldId, value) {
const event = new CustomEvent('widget-change', {
detail: { fieldId, value },
bubbles: true
});
document.dispatchEvent(event);
}
}
});
Example 2: Slider Widget
window.LEDMatrixWidgets.register('slider', {
name: 'Slider Widget',
version: '1.0.0',
render: function(container, config, value, options) {
const fieldId = options.fieldId;
// Sanitize fieldId for safe use in DOM IDs and selectors
const sanitizeId = (id) => String(id).replace(/[^a-zA-Z0-9_-]/g, '_');
const sanitizedFieldId = sanitizeId(fieldId);
const min = config.minimum || 0;
const max = config.maximum || 100;
const step = config.step || 1;
const currentValue = value !== undefined ? value : (config.default || min);
container.innerHTML = `
<div class="slider-widget">
<input type="range"
id="${sanitizedFieldId}_slider"
min="${min}"
max="${max}"
step="${step}"
value="${currentValue}"
class="w-full">
<div class="flex justify-between text-xs text-gray-500 mt-1">
<span>${min}</span>
<span id="${sanitizedFieldId}_value">${currentValue}</span>
<span>${max}</span>
</div>
</div>
`;
const slider = container.querySelector(`#${sanitizedFieldId}_slider`);
const valueDisplay = container.querySelector(`#${sanitizedFieldId}_value`);
if (slider && valueDisplay) {
slider.addEventListener('input', (e) => {
valueDisplay.textContent = e.target.value;
this.handlers.onChange(fieldId, parseFloat(e.target.value));
});
}
},
getValue: function(fieldId) {
// Sanitize fieldId for safe selector use
const sanitizeId = (id) => String(id).replace(/[^a-zA-Z0-9_-]/g, '_');
const sanitizedFieldId = sanitizeId(fieldId);
const slider = document.querySelector(`#${sanitizedFieldId}_slider`);
return slider ? parseFloat(slider.value) : null;
},
setValue: function(fieldId, value) {
// Sanitize fieldId for safe selector use
const sanitizeId = (id) => String(id).replace(/[^a-zA-Z0-9_-]/g, '_');
const sanitizedFieldId = sanitizeId(fieldId);
const slider = document.querySelector(`#${sanitizedFieldId}_slider`);
const valueDisplay = document.querySelector(`#${sanitizedFieldId}_value`);
if (slider) {
slider.value = value;
if (valueDisplay) {
valueDisplay.textContent = value;
}
}
},
handlers: {
onChange: function(fieldId, value) {
const event = new CustomEvent('widget-change', {
detail: { fieldId, value },
bubbles: true
});
document.dispatchEvent(event);
}
}
});
Troubleshooting
Widget Not Loading
- Check browser console for errors
- Verify widget file path is correct
- Ensure
LEDMatrixWidgets.register()is called - Check that widget name matches schema
x-widgetvalue
Widget Not Rendering
- Verify
renderfunction is defined - Check container element exists
- Ensure widget is registered before form loads
- Check for JavaScript errors in console
Value Not Saving
- Ensure widget triggers
widget-changeevent - Verify form submission includes widget value
- Check
getValuefunction returns correct type - Verify field name matches schema property
Migration from Server-Side Rendering
Currently, widgets are server-side rendered via Jinja2 templates. The registry system provides:
- Backwards Compatibility: Existing server-side rendered widgets continue to work
- Future Enhancement: Client-side rendering support for custom widgets
- Handler Availability: All widget handlers are available globally
Future versions may support full client-side rendering, but server-side rendering remains the primary method for core widgets.
